Product Introduction

Overview

The HMC698LP5ETR from Analog Devices Inc. is a high-performance Phase Locked Loop (PLL) frequency synthesizer. This component is designed to provide a wide range of frequency synthesis capabilities, making it suitable for various RF and microwave applications. It features a reversible polarity digital Phase Frequency Detector (PFD) and a lock detect output, ensuring robust and reliable operation.
